What you'll actually pay

Average net price per year β€” tuition, fees, room & board minus grant and scholarship aid β€” for in-state students by household income.

Household incomeAvg net price / year
Under $30,000$14,080
$30,000 – $48,000$17,108
$48,000 – $75,000$15,967
$75,000 – $110,000$22,603
Over $110,000$24,782
All incomes (average)$19,676

Sticker tuition: $37,500 in-state β€” before aid.
